Многоканальный программируемый генератор импульсов Советский патент 1984 года по МПК H03K3/84 

Описание патента на изобретение SU1084978A1

Изобретение относится к импульсной технике и может быть использовано в контрольно-измерительном оборудовании для проверки электронньк блоков и интегральных схем различной степени интеграции.

Известен многоканальный программируемый генератор импульсов, содержащий источник опорной частоты, счетчик числа тактов, датчик кода числа тактов, схему сравнения и несколько каналов, каждый из которых содержит выходной триггер, счетчик времени задержки, счетчик длительности импульсов, датчик кода времени задержки, датчик кода длительности импульсов, триггер синхронизации, элемент

ИЛИ, два трехвходовых элемента И tOНедостатками устройства являются его сложность и ограниченные функциональные возможности.

Наиболее близким к изобретению по технической сущности является многоканальный программируемый генератор импульсов, содержащий общий для всех каналов генератор опорной частоты, в каждом канале вычитающий счетчик, выход которого соединен с входом разрешения записи кода, датчик кодов временных интервалов, выходы которого соединены с входами вычитающего счетчика задержки и с входами вычитающего счетчика длительности импульсов, и устройство управления, состоящее из двух триггеров, двух логических элементов И и одного элемента ИЛИ 2.

Недостатками известного устройства являются ограниченные функциональ ные возможности, связанные с невозможностью формирования импульсов в каналах с различной частотой следования, а также его сложность.

Цель изобретения - расширение функциональных возможностей генератора импульсов, связанных с раздельным программированием в каждом канале периода повторения импульсов, а также его упрощение.

Поставленная цель достигается тем, что в многоканальном программируемом генераторе импульсов, содержащем общий для всех каналов генератор опорной частоты, выход которого соединен в каждом канапе со счетным входом п-разрядного вычитающего счетчика, выход которого соединен с его входом разрешения записи кода.

И в каждом канале датчик кодов временных интервалов, датчик кодов временных интервалов в каждом канале выполнен в виде п-ь1-го трехразрядного, кольцевого сдвигающего регистра, причем выход вычитающего счетчика соединен с входом сдвига информации датчика кодов временных интервалов, выходы п кольцевых сдвигающих регистров соединены с входами записи кода соответствукнцего п-разрядного вычитающего счетчика, входы разрядов п-трехразрядных кольцевых сдвигающих регистров соединены с шиной программирования задержки, длительности и периода повторения импульсов, вход одного из разрядов п+1-го трехразрядного кольцевого сдвигающего регистра соединен с шиной записи логической единицы, а выходы остальных разрядовП+1-ГО трехразрядного кольцевого

сдвигающего регистра соединены с выходными шинами одного из каналов .многоканального программируемого генератора импульсов.

На чертеже изображена блок-схема предлагаемого многоканального программируемого генератора импульсов.

Устройство содержит генератор 1 опорной частоты и каналы 2-1, 2-2, ..., 2-N (формирования импульсов), канадый из которых состоит из п-разрядного вычитающего счетчика 3 и датчика 4 кодов временных интервалов, выполненного в виде п+1 трехразрядных кольцевых сдвигающих регистров 5-1, ..., 5-3-(п+1). Выход генератора 1 опорной частоты соединен в каждом канале со счетным входом п-разрядного вычитающего счетчика, выход которого соединен с его входом разрешения записи кода счетчика и входом сдвига информации датчика кодов временных интервалов, выходы п трехразрядных кольцевых сдвигающих регистров соединены со входами записи кодо вычитающего счетчика 3, первый и второй выходы 6 и 7 п-И трехразрядного кольцевого сдвигающего регистра являются выходными шинами соответствующего канала, входы разрядов п трехразрядных кольцевых сдвигающих регистров соединены с шиной 8 программирования задержки, длительности и периода повторения импульсов, вход одного из разрядов п+1 трехразрядног кольцевого сдвигакяцего регистра соединен с шиной 9 записи логической единицы. Многоканальный программируемый reijepaTop импульсов работает следую щим образом. В исходном состоянии в вычитающий счетчик 3 из оперативной памяти датчика 4 кодов чисел временных интервалов занесен код .числа задерж ки формируемого импульса. На выкодах вычитающего счетчика 3 и каналов 2-1, ..., 2-N, выходах 6 и 7 регистра в исходном состоянии установлен нижний уровень напряжения, соответствующий нулевому состоянию. При запуске устройства тактовые импульсы с выхода генератора 1 опорно частоты поступают на входы вычитающих счетчиков 3 каналов 2-1, ..., 2-N. Вычитающий счетчик 3 работает на вычитание до достижения нулевого состояния, после на его выходе установится высокий уровень напряжения, соответствующий единичному состоянию. Импульс с выхода вычитающего счетчика 3 подается на ;его же вход и вход датчика 4 кодов чисел временных интервалов, с выхода которого, по поступлении этого импульса, в вычитающий счетчик 3 заносится код длительности, а на вы ходе 6 регистра канала устанавливае ся высокий уровень, соответствующий переднему фронту формируемого импульса. При достижении вычитающим счетчиком 3 нулевого состояния вторично его выходным импульсом производится запись кода паузы,.а на выходе 6 регистра канала устанавливается низкий потенциал, соответствую щий заднему фронту формируемого импульса. При достижении вычитающим счетчиком 3 нулевого состояния в третий раз в него описанным образом производится запись кода числа задержки, а на выходе 7 регистра кана лов устанавливается высокий потенциал, соответствующий формируемому периоду. Далее процесс формирования импульсов повторяется. При этом обе печивается формирование импульсов с любым соотношением его параметров (задержки, длительности и периода), коды чисел которых хранятся в оперативном запоминающем устройстве датчика 4 кодов и могут принимать любые значения. Датчик 4 кодов чисел временных интервалов каждого канала предназначен для хранения значений задержки длительности и паузы, а также для формирования периода и задержанного импульса заданной длительности. При этом значении пауза представляет собой разность между значением величины формируемого периода и суммы значений задержки и длительности формируемого импульса, В качестве датчика 4 кодов чисел временных интервалов применено оперативное запоминающее устройство, выполненное на сдвиговых регистрах (микросхемах 500 серии), имеющих в ширину п+1 разряда (где п определяется разрядностью вычитающего счетчика, а один разряд обеспечивает выходы 6 и 7 регистров каналов генератора, а в глубину - три разряда, коды задержки, длительности и пауза), При таком выполнении датчика кодов временных интервалов в каналах устройства обеспечивается автономное программирование периода выходного импульса за счет того, что датчик кодов временных интервалов выполняет функции датчиков кодов времени задержки, длительности и паузы. Совмещение перечисленных функций в одном узле оказалось возможным за счет выполнения датчика кодов временных интервалов в виде оперативного запоминающего устройства, что значительно упрощает схему устройства и повышает надежность его работы. Таким образом, в предлагаемом техническом решении реализуется возможность формирования импульсов в каналах с различной частотой следования с одновременным упрощением устройства.

Похожие патенты SU1084978A1

название год авторы номер документа
Делитель частоты следования импульсов 1982
  • Ворожеев Валентин Федорович
  • Панов Александр Иванович
SU1150755A1
Многоканальный преобразователь кода во временной интервал 1985
  • Айдемиров Игорь Айдемирович
  • Омаров Омар Магадович
SU1322479A1
Многоканальный программируемый генератор импульсов 1981
  • Самсонов Владимир Ильич
SU953703A2
Многоканальный программируемый генератор импульсов 1986
  • Амбурцев Михаил Михайлович
  • Фихман Михаил Исаакович
SU1374413A1
Многоканальный программируемый генератор импульсов 1986
  • Алцыбеев Юрий Николаевич
SU1431038A1
Информационное устройство 1987
  • Козубов Вячеслав Николаевич
SU1564066A1
Устройство для автоматического контроля больших интегральных схем 1984
  • Панов Александр Иванович
  • Ворожеев Валентин Федорович
  • Зыбенков Сергей Николаевич
SU1205083A1
Многоканальное устройство для формирования импульсных последовательностей 1982
  • Очеретяный А.Н.
  • Богородицкий Л.А.
  • Гаврилов Ю.В.
SU1077539A1
Многоканальный измеритель интервалов времени 1989
  • Берестов С.И.
  • Сажин С.А.
  • Субботин В.Т.
  • Черников В.И.
SU1651686A1
Функциональный генератор 1987
  • Пысин Олег Константинович
  • Социленков Александр Александрович
SU1501100A1

Реферат патента 1984 года Многоканальный программируемый генератор импульсов

МНОГОКАНАЛЬНЫЙ ПРОГРАММИРУЕМЫЙ ГЕНЕРАТОР ИМПУЛЬСОВ, содержа щий общий для всех каналов генерато опорной частоты, выход которого сое динен в каждом канале со счетным вх дом п-разрядного вычитающего счетчи ка, выход которого соединен с его входом разрешения записи кода, и в каждом канале датчик кодов временных интервалов, отличающийся тем, что, с целью расшир ния функциональных возможностей генератора импульсов, связанных с раз дельным программированием в каждом канале периода повторения импульсов, а также его упрощения, датчик кодов временных интервалов в каяздом канале выполнен в виде п+1-го трехразрядного кольцезого сдвигающего регистра, причем выход вычитающего счетчика соединен с входом сдвига информации датчика кодов временных интервалов, выходы п кольцевых сдвигающих регистров соединены с входами записи кода соответствующего п-разрядного вьгчита-. ющего счетчика, входы разрядов птрехразрядных кольцевых сдвигающих регистров соединены с шиной программирования задержки, длительности и периода повторения импульсов, вход одного из разрядов п- -1-го трехразрядного кольцевого сдвигающего регистра соединен с шиной записи логической единицы, а выходы остальных разрядов п+1-го трехразрядного кольцевого сдвигающего регистра соединены с выходными шинами одного из каналов многоканального программируемого генератора импульсов. S-lln f) f-Jfn r)

Документы, цитированные в отчете о поиске Патент 1984 года SU1084978A1

Печь для непрерывного получения сернистого натрия 1921
  • Настюков А.М.
  • Настюков К.И.
SU1A1
Многоканальный генератор импульсов 1974
  • Гончаров Эдуард Федорович
  • Капитонов Олег Константинович
  • Кутузов Евгений Васильевич
SU516183A1
Переносная печь для варки пищи и отопления в окопах, походных помещениях и т.п. 1921
  • Богач Б.И.
SU3A1
Аппарат для очищения воды при помощи химических реактивов 1917
  • Гордон И.Д.
SU2A1
Многоканальный генератор импульсов 1978
  • Белокрылов Валерий Денисович
  • Душанина Нина Георгиевна
  • Страхов Алексей Федорович
SU799112A1
Переносная печь для варки пищи и отопления в окопах, походных помещениях и т.п. 1921
  • Богач Б.И.
SU3A1

SU 1 084 978 A1

Авторы

Панов Александр Иванович

Ворожеев Валентин Федорович

Даты

1984-04-07Публикация

1981-12-29Подача